Aboriginal Apprenticeship Board of Ontario

The Aboriginal Apprenticeship Board of Ontario (AABO) is a not-for-profit organization dedicated to increasing the number of Aboriginal people in the trades in Ontario. The AABO is the embodiment of the Ontario-based Aboriginal Apprenticeship Strategy as defined in the document “Supply Meeting Demand.”. Its purpose is to ensure that the ... Visit website

Apprenticeship Service - Canada.ca

About the Apprenticeship Service. From: Employment and Social Development Canada. The Apprenticeship Service supports employers to hire new first-year apprentices in 39 Red Seal trades. It also helps first-year apprentices get the hands-on work experience they need for a career in the skilled trades. Visit website

Aboriginal Apprenticeship Program - CMEC

The Aboriginal Apprenticeship Program is an innovative approach, providing accessibility to trades training to northern and rural First Nation and Métis communities. Apprentices are able to complete the classroom component of their apprenticeship training in or near their home communities. As well, on-site training also provides Visit website

Aboriginal Apprenticeship Initiative - Gabriel Dumont Institute

The goals of the Initiative included having 140 apprentices indentured with the Saskatchewan Apprenticeship and Trades Certification Commission (SATCC), and partnering with at least 60 individual companies in 17 different industries. The GDI Initiative met and or exceeded all the targets. It placed 223 Aboriginal clients with employers, of ... Visit website

Aboriginal Employment, Training, Skill and Labour Market Centres

In Canada, there are 80 Aboriginal Employment, Skills and Training (ASET) agreement holders (aka, Aboriginal Employment, Skills and Training / Labour Market Centres) that host approximately 400 additional satellite delivery locations across Canada. Each centre serves as a direct source to help Aboriginal people with their employment, training and job search requirements. Visit website

Aboriginal Applicants - NAIT

Self-identified Aboriginal learners are not required to provide a tuition deposit. Tuition deposits can create financial barriers to post-secondary for Aboriginal applicants. By waiving the tuition deposit, NAIT can support applicants in pursuing their education goals and achieving their polytechnic potential. This means that an initial deposit ... Visit website
